38 gallon African Biotope
Hello I was wondering what to do with with my 38 gallon and wanted to hear your suggestions. I did have a few ideas such as making it a lake Tangikanya shell dweller tank or a Lake Malawi tank that has a colony of Demasoni cichlids. The setups would be:
Malawi: Demasoni Cichlids Johanni Cichlids Bristlenose Pleco Zebra Cichlids or Electric yellow cichlids Tangikanya: Colony of Multis or Ocellated shell dwellers Synodontis Petricola Maybe a school of African Moon Tetras (I know they are not from the lake but they are located in the Congo) And possibly another kind of cichlid Also I don't want to do a planted tank as I am doing that with a 55 gallon and I have always wanted a nice biotope aquarium Hope you can help me.
